Product features
sWave® wireless technology
4 potential-free optocoupler outputs
Transmitter/receiver assignment by teaching mode
LEDs for indication of switching state
Notes
External antenna always required for optimum wireless range
Technical data
General technical data
Applied standards
EN 60947-5-1, EN 61000-6-2, EN 61000-6-3, EN 61000-4-4, EN 61000-4-5, EN 61000-4-6, EN 60068-2-6, EN 60068-2-27, EN 301 489-1, EN 301 489-3, EN 300 220-1, EN 300 220-2
Enclosure
thermoplastic, glass-fibre reinforced, shockproof, self-extinguishing UL 94 V-0
Degree of protection
IP20 (IEC/EN 60529)
Number of channels
4
Mounting
DIN rail mounting
Connection
screw connection terminals 0.14 mm² - 2,5 mm², stripping length 8 mm
Inputs
2 additional push buttons (SEL, LRN)
Outputs
4 potential-free normally open contacts (optoelectronic photo relays)
Rated operating voltage range UB
12...48 VDC (-10 % ... +25 %, abs. max. 60 V)
Rated operating current Ie
48 VDC: max. 16 mA
24 VDC: max. 21 mA
Current absorption
at 48 VDC:
typ. 1.9 mA (standby current)
typ. 8 mA (1 output switched)
typ. 8 mA (2 outputs switched)
typ. 9 mA (3 outputs switched)
typ. 10 mA (4 outputs switched)
Rated operating voltage Ue
48 VDC
Rated operating current/voltage Ie/Ue
output contacts: 0.5 A / 48 VDC (abs. max. 60 V)
Utilisation category
DC-13
Display
green LED: ready for operation,
orange LED: signalling of switching state
Telegram rate
max. 12000 telegrams with repetitions/h
Degree of pollution
2
Ambient temperature
0 °C … +55 °C
Storage and shipping temperature
–25 °C … +85 °C
Note
Inductive loads (contactors, relays etc.) are to be suppressed by suitable circuitry.
Switching contacts are not suitable for capacitive loads.
Wireless approvals
Europe: RED 2014/53/EU
Wireless technology
Protocol
sWave®
Frequency
868.3 MHz (Europe)
Transmission power
< 25 mW
Data rate
66 kbps
Channel bandwidth
480 kHz
Wireless range
max. 700 m outdoors, max. 50 m indoors
